local cemetary garden

local cemetary garden by pluckyfilly


Quote: Good capture of colours Ann but looking at this it is very bright and also showing signs of over-processing. The overal detail merges into each other and renders it blurred. Also looking at the darks their is significant noise especially on the tree trunk and darker greens.
I hope you take this in the way it is meant as sound critique as these signs are what set this apart from many others seen.
Richard

Hope you don't mind me sticking my nose in but I noticed that it's not the processing that's the problem, if you check the exif data the camera was set at ISO 6400 that's why it's not very sharp and why there is noise in the darker areas. Just a passing comment, nice colours though.
